The embodiment of the invention provides a method for determining a train operation plan, which comprises the following steps: acquiring the position of a previous train, and acquiring the time pointwhen the previous train begins to decelerate based on the position of the previous train; based on the time point when the previous train starts to decelerate, determining the time point when the current train starts to leave the station at the current station; wherein the previous train and the current train are located in the same power supply interval, and the power supply interval comprises aplurality of stations; and determining an operation plan of the current train based on the time point when the current train starts to leave the station at the current station. For trains running in the same power supply interval, the running of the next train is controlled according to the running characteristics of the previous train, the time point when the current train absorbs energy to the power supply interval is determined based on the time point when the previous train feeds back energy to the power supply interval, and the energy fed back to the power supply interval during train braking is fully utilized. Braking energy of the train is used for traction of other trains, and therefore energy-saving operation of the train in the power supply interval is achieved.
